A first intermediate compound, 7-Chloro-3-methyl-1H-[1,8]naphthyridin-2-one, was produced as follows: Diisopropyl amine (freshly distilled over sodium, 12.8 mL, 91.4 mmol, 2.2 equiv.) was dissolved in Et2O (40 mL) and cooled to −78° C. Butyl lithium (2.5 M solution in hexane, 37.0 mL, 91.4 mmol, 2.2 equiv.) was added slowly under nitrogen atmosphere. The mixture was stirred for 15 min and t-butyl propionate (13.8 mL, 91.4 mmol, 2.2 equiv.) was added as a solution in dry THF (20 mL). The reaction mixture was stirred for 30 min and N-(6-chloro-3-formyl-pyridin-2-yl)-2,2-dimethyl-propionamide (10.0 g, 42.0 mmol, 1.0 equiv.) was added as a solution in a minimum amount of dry THF (35 mL). A bright yellow precipitate was formed within 10 min and stirring became difficult. The reaction was allowed to warm up to RT. The reaction mixture turned dark red and was poured into saturated NH4Cl (100 mL). The organic layer was separated and the aqueous layer was extracted with CH2Cl2. The combined organic layers were dried over Na2SO4 and concentrated. 3-[6-Chloro-2-(2,2-dimethyl-propionylamino)-pyridin-3-yl]-3-hydroxy-2-methyl-propionic acid tert-butyl ester was obtained as a yellow thick syrup which upon drying under high vacuum became a foamy solid (20.0 g, crude). The product was used in the next step without further purification.
